The New Zealand-based security product company Gallagher plans to set up an office in Thailand. Sir William Gallagher, CEO of Gallagher, joined an official visit of New Zealand Prime Minister to Bangkok, as the company prepares to open an office in the region. The company has customers in more than 160 countries, and reports increasing demand from the Asian market.

Sir William said: “The on-going growth of the Asian market provides a range of opportunities and prospects for Gallagher. The region, like many others, is developing a new understanding of the importance of comprehensive security systems, which not only ensure the safety of employees at work but vitally reinforcing business continuity. Supported by our growing team and network of channel partners, the company is fully focused on further developing our presence in this innovative and industrious region.”

Gallagher’s equipment has already integrated access and perimeter installations at institutions including The Bank of Thailand and Siemens Airport Rail Link.

Gallagher’s Bangkok office will be open by the end of the year and company is recruiting staff to support this.

Gallagher’s products integrate electronic access control, intruder alarms, perimeter security systems and also integrate digital video, biometrics and people management. Its perimeter security product includes electric fence, wire tension and vibration sensors.
